Skip to content

mattermostmodelsusers User

BigMakCode edited this page Aug 5, 2024 · 1 revision

User Public class

Description

User information.

Diagram

  flowchart LR
  classDef interfaceStyle stroke-dasharray: 5 5;
  classDef abstractStyle stroke-width:4px
  subgraph Mattermost.Models.Users
  Mattermost.Models.Users.User[[User]]
  end
Loading

Members

Properties

Public properties

Type Name Methods
string AuthData
User authentication data.
get, set
string AuthService
User authentication service (ex. Gitlab, GMail etc.)
get, set
string BotDescription
If is bot, description here.
get, set
long CreatedAt
The time in milliseconds a user was created.
get, set
int DeletedAt
The time in milliseconds a user was deleted.
get, set
bool DisableWelcomeEmail
Disable welcome email for the user.
get, set
string Email
E-Mail.
get, set
string FirstName
First name.
get, set
string Id
User identifier.
get, set
bool IsBot
Is bot?
get, set
string LastName
Last name.
get, set
long LastPasswordUpdate
The time in milliseconds a user password was last updated.
get, set
long LastPictureUpdate
The time in milliseconds a user picture was last updated.
get, set
string Locale
User locale (ex. en-US, ru-RU etc.)
get, set
string Nickname
User nickname.
get, set
NotifyProps NotifyProps
User notify properties.
get, set
string Position
User position.
get, set
string Roles
User roles.
get, set
Timezone Timezone
User timezone.
get, set
long UpdatedAt
The time in milliseconds a user was last updated.
get, set
string Username
Username.
get, set

Details

Summary

User information.

Constructors

User

public User()

Properties

Id

public string Id { get; set; }
Summary

User identifier.

CreatedAt

public long CreatedAt { get; set; }
Summary

The time in milliseconds a user was created.

UpdatedAt

public long UpdatedAt { get; set; }
Summary

The time in milliseconds a user was last updated.

DeletedAt

public int DeletedAt { get; set; }
Summary

The time in milliseconds a user was deleted.

Username

public string Username { get; set; }
Summary

Username.

AuthData

public string AuthData { get; set; }
Summary

User authentication data.

AuthService

public string AuthService { get; set; }
Summary

User authentication service (ex. Gitlab, GMail etc.)

Email

public string Email { get; set; }
Summary

E-Mail.

Nickname

public string Nickname { get; set; }
Summary

User nickname.

FirstName

public string FirstName { get; set; }
Summary

First name.

LastName

public string LastName { get; set; }
Summary

Last name.

Position

public string Position { get; set; }
Summary

User position.

Roles

public string Roles { get; set; }
Summary

User roles.

NotifyProps

public NotifyProps NotifyProps { get; set; }
Summary

User notify properties.

LastPasswordUpdate

public long LastPasswordUpdate { get; set; }
Summary

The time in milliseconds a user password was last updated.

LastPictureUpdate

public long LastPictureUpdate { get; set; }
Summary

The time in milliseconds a user picture was last updated.

Locale

public string Locale { get; set; }
Summary

User locale (ex. en-US, ru-RU etc.)

Timezone

public Timezone Timezone { get; set; }
Summary

User timezone.

IsBot

public bool IsBot { get; set; }
Summary

Is bot?

BotDescription

public string BotDescription { get; set; }
Summary

If is bot, description here.

DisableWelcomeEmail

public bool DisableWelcomeEmail { get; set; }
Summary

Disable welcome email for the user.

Generated with ModularDoc

Clone this wiki locally